Default acer aspire 3680 WAN driver won't start

I've got an acer aspire 3680-2576 laptop. I'm installing XP Home SP2 on it.
The wireless driver installs but windows reports "device cannot start, code
10." I tried all the wireless drivers listed for this computer on the acer
site and this is the only one that installs. It's the "atheros AR5600X"
driver. Rebooting makes no difference. Uninstalling and re-installing makes
no difference. The wireless switch on the front of the computer doesn't
light when the switch is pushed. Any ideas what to do? Thanks.

This may be my first post but thats beside the point, if when you dual boot vista/xp and in vista the card in question works and connects to the internet just fine using the supplied acer driver, but when you boot into xp using that same card and the supplied xp driver from acer you simply get the device cannot start. I also noticed an earlier post for aspire 3680-2633 and the driver under xp was installing the "atheros AR5600X" driver while mine is an aspire 3680-2682, anyways my point is the card has to work and therefore acer must either have a bad driver OR the driver is installing the incorrect version for that card... there are models besides the ar5600x that are packed into that driver set. Smply power off your machine and remove the battery, then on the bottom of your notebook there will be 2 access panels. The smaller one is the access panel to your sata hdd/ide hdd, while the larger one with the Vista OEM sticker contains your RAM, modem, wireless card, and possibly bluetooth device. Remove the panel by loosing the two screws (don't worry they do not come all the way out) then just pop the cover off using your fingernail at the center lift point.the card the with black and white wires attached to it is your wireless card.
remove the two screw holding it down and the card will lift up at an angle but be CAREFUL because if you lift the card into a bind it will break! now that you have removed it from its socket on the bottom side you will see the model under the fcc id, mine is an "Atheros AR5BXB63" not the the "atheros AR5600X" that the driver tries to install by default. Now that you have your card model simply put your notebook back together the same way you took it apart and use THIS driver for the install Download Atheros AR5xxx Driver 5.1.1.9 Driver for Windows 95/98/9X/ME/NT/2000/2K/XP/2003 - Softpedia btw also u might have to do a manual install and pick the AR5007EG vesion like i did, after that problem solved!
( In case the black and white wires come off the black is the main and the white wire is the aux.)
